Electromagnetic Feeder

EFI Electro Magnetic Feeder increase bulk handling productivity with Variable controlled feed rates. These versatile feeders are capable of handling a variety of materials from the finest powders to large, coarse particles. The capacities ranging from 25 to 1600 tons per hour. Capacities vary depending on drive unit location, material characteristics, material density, trough length and width, trough liner type, feeder installation, skirt boards and hopper transitions.
There are no mechanical parts to wear out, such as cams, eccentrics, belts and bearings. All movement is confined to the leaf springs. Electrical components, such as the coil, will provide years of service under normal operating conditions.

Electromechanical Feeder

EFI Mechanical Feeder with unbalance motor drives is economical conveying means for all bulk materials. Compared with other conveying means vibratory feeders have low energy consumption. The vibration is achieved by the eccentric movement of the out of unbalanced weights mounted on each side of motor, twin motor vibrator drives arranged for counter-rotation, provide linear vibratory action, which conveys the product across the vibrating surface.

Bowl Feeder

''EFI'' Bowl Feeder Stainless Steel bowls is custom built to meet exact customer specifications, regarding part configuration, feed rate and orientation. To ensure the precise handling of almost any size and type of part - whether small or large, delicate or heavy duty .The sizes ranging from 6" basic diameter up to 36". All bowls are fabricated from 11 gauges stainless. We offer complete bowl tooling for your specific parts and feed rate requirements.
